Title:
RECYCLED MATERIAL BASED ON IN-SITU COMPATIBILIZATION AND CHAIN EXTENSION AND PREPARATION METHOD THEREFOR

Abstract:
A recycled material based on in-situ compatibilization and chain extension. The recycled material is mainly prepared from the following raw materials in parts by mass: 30-70 parts of waste HIPS; 30-70 parts of waste PP; 2-6 parts of POE; 0.1-0.4 part of an alkylation reaction catalyst; 0.1-0.3 part of a co-catalyst; and 2-8 parts of a macromolecular chain extender. The recycled material uses waste HIPS and waste PP as raw materials, two types of chemical modifiers are used in a segmented and matched mode, and in-situ compatibilization and chain extension repairing effects are achieved by means of grafting and chain extension reaction, respectively, so that the recycled material having excellent comprehensive performance is prepared by directly performing in-situ modification on the waste HIPS and the waste PP, and a high-valued attribute is also embodied while waste resources are fully used. Further disclosed is a preparation method for the recycled material based on in-situ compatibilization and chain extension.
